The Anytone AT-588 VHF is a mobile VHF transceiver. It covers 134-174 MHz for both receive and transmit. Frequency stability is ±2.5 p.p.m. Tuning steps are selectable from 5 to 50 kHz. Image rejection is ≥60 dB. RF output is selectable at 10, 25 or 60 W. Audio output is 2 W. It features CTCSS/DCS and has 1 memory bank with 200 channels. Power requirements are 13.8 V DC (±15%). Current drain is 600 mA in receive and 9 A in transmit. Dimensions are 47 × 145 × 190 mm.
